Enter Stone’s Edge, a shawl with a modern take on a geometric pattern in lovely pink and grey shades of Kingston Tweed. The rustic texture of the yarn mixed with the pattern of the shawl make for an accessory that would feel just right on a mountain retreat or out for a day in the city.
SIZES One Size
FINISHED MEASUREMENTS Wingspan: 60” Depth at Center: 25”
MATERIALS Fibra Natura Kingston Tweed (50% wool, 25% alpaca, 25% mixed; 50g/194 yds) 112 Basalt (Color A) – 4 skeins 103 Gypsum (Color B) – 3 skeins Hook: US Size E-4 (3.5mm) or size needed to obtain gauge Notions: Tapestry needle
GAUGE 17 sts x 22 rows = 4” in pattern stitch Save time, check your gauge.
PATTERN NOTES Stone’s Edge is worked flat in one piece. This pattern is worked in two colors; when changing colors, carry the yarn loosely up the side.
Always work over the ch-2 and ch-4 spaces of the previous 2 rows.
